CHAPTER 2
4 . Protective
functions
The printer is equipped with the following protective functions to prevent malfunction of the fixing
h e a t e r :
a . Thermistor (detecting overheating)
The ASIC and the high-temperature detection circuit found on the DC controller PCB monitors the
voltage readings of the main thermistor and the sub thermistor; if the main thermistor detects a
voltage level which is equivalent of the following temperature, the CPU will identify the condition
as being overheating:
220°C or higher (by main thermistor TH101)
b . Thermistor (detecting connector disconnection)
The connector disconnection detection circuit found on the DC controller PCB monitors the THCNCT
signal; if the THCNCT signal goes Low, the CPU will identify the condition as indicating disconnec-
tion of the thermistor connector.
c . Thermistor (cutting the power for overheating)
If the internal temperature of the thermal switch (THSW101) exceeds about 230°C, thermal switch
will go OFF, thereby cutting the power to the fixing heater.
d . Detecting the activation of the fixing heater
The fixing heater activation detection circuit found on the power supply PCB assumes that the /
HEATDT signal is Low if the /FSRDRV signal is Low (fixing heater ON). If /HEATDT goes High
while /FSRDRV signal is Low (fixing heater ON), the ASIC will identify the condition to be an error
in the activation of the fixing heater (triac short circuit).
